- In 2008, with "Echigo-Nan 165" as the father and "Yumesansui" as the mother, the first sake rice "Kami no Ho" was born and raised in the Land of God. The first sake rice from Mie Prefecture, "Kaminoho," was born and raised in the Land of God. Junmai Ginjo-shu is brewed with Mie Prefecture's sake rice "Kami no Ho" using Mie Prefecture yeast. This premium Gizaemon is freshly squeezed and bottled immediately after bottling at a temperature of -3°C (-4°F). It has a mellow aroma and a refreshing taste.
